A DAY IN THE LIFE:
We have 2 openings for this role - (.NET/SQL/JS)
Independently performs IT functions such as development, design, analysis, evaluation, testing, debugging and implementation of business applications in support of cross-functional enterprise areas. Drives the process of gathering requirements, analyzing data, and automating business process with software solutions.
YOU’RE AWESOME AT:
Independently designs and develops custom solutions using Microsoft Development Tools for existing business systems.
Reviews escalated end user issues; identifies and implements solutions.
Participates in and is responsible for programs and system development, configuration and implementation of systems and tools selection.
Works closely with department heads to proactively identify area of system improvement as well as opportunities for system automation.
Learns to work with personnel of organizational units involved to identify problems, learns specific input and output requirements such as forms of data input, how data is to be summarized, and formats for reports.
Reviews system capabilities, workflows, and scheduling limitations to determine if requested program or program change is possible within existing system.
Reviews and analyzes project scope in order to determine time and resource estimates.
Plans and prepares technical reports and instructional manuals as documentation of program development.
May independently manage working interactions with external vendors and resources ensuring that deliverable and timelines are met.
Responsible for software design specifications, interface descriptions, and other software documentations.
May act as technical lead for both individual projects and/or entire products.
Translates high-level requirements into software design and implementation.
Responsible for the training, mentoring and development of junior team members. Ensures compliance with company policies, including Privacy/HIPAA, and other legal and regulatory requirements.
EXTRA AWESOME:
B.S. in computer science or equivalent combination of education and applicable job experience.
7+ years of experience working in a business applications environment.
2+ years of experience of Dynamics CRM development.
Experience with development in enterprise systems.
Experience with .NET, MSSQL and web development.
Experience using C#, SQL Server, or similar products.
Transact-SQL development experience.
